Output 7e09fc6aaf39ecd00ba81b4abe960e0fc9b67637408d1bb4d38d5b43f39e266a:22

value
10692
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d51a2396f4253b700e8bca6768d02edb1901773b03a19124a101bf0ddee313a9
address
ltc1p65dz89h5y5ahqr5tefnk35pwmvvszaemqwsezf9pqxlsmhhrzw5sh549d0
transaction
7e09fc6aaf39ecd00ba81b4abe960e0fc9b67637408d1bb4d38d5b43f39e266a
spent
true